== Function ==
 +
[[http://www.uniprot.org/uniprot/FFAR1_HUMAN FFAR1_HUMAN]] Receptor for medium and long chain saturated and unsaturated fatty acids. Binding of the ligand increase intracellular calcium concentration and amplify glucose-stimulated insulin secretion. The activity of this receptor is mediated by G-proteins that activate phospholipase C. Seems to act through a G(q) and G(i)-mediated pathway.<ref>PMID:12496284</ref>
